A New Frigorifick Experiment Shewing How a Considerable Degree of Cold May be Suddenly Produced Without the Help of Snow, Ice, Haile....at Any Time of Year
- London: The Royal Society of London, 1666
London: The Royal Society of London, 1666. First Edition. Very Good. Octavo, pp. 255 - 262 of the Philosophical transactions, Number 15. This article is a supplement to Boyle's 1663 publication "New Experiments and Observations Touching Cold." This was published shortly after "Boyle's Law" (1662), stating that the volume of a gas varies inversely with pressure. Printed on laid paper, unbound.
